The first part of the series is relatively straight forward. Kishiryuu is literally just "Knight Dragon". Ryuusouger is a little trickier. Ryuu mostly likely means dragon here, but the "sou" part could be a couple of different things. It could be "sou" as in monk/priest or it could be "sou" from busou, meaning arms or armament.

Gonna disagree with you on that, cause the way Japan pronounces soldier is "sorujyaa". The suffix is definitely "-ger" in this case and we had the "-ger" suffix since Boukenger. So essentially it is "ryusou + ger", ryusou most likely meaning something in the line of draconic equip/armament like Aoi and I pointed out previously, and which leads to two other speculations; if naming schemes from past sentais are any indication code names will probably be something in the lines of "Ryusou [insert color]" such as Ryusou Red, etc. unless they pull a Zyuohger and go "Ryusou [insert subspecies of dragon]" such as Ryusou Dragon/Wyvern, etc. Another speculation I can think of is that the word "ryusou" will be the phrase for when they transform. And with all this in mind I bet Ryusouger can be written as 竜装者 in kanji.
